check_active — Is I/O active longer than?
Description
bool check_active(uint8 io, uint32 ms);
Check if the I/O indexed by io is in active state for ms milli-seconds or more.
check_active() is the combination of is_active() with time_active() . |
Parameters
- io: Index of an I/O.
- ms: Time expressed in milli-seconds.
Return Value
Returns true if the I/O is active longer than ms milli-seconds, FALSE
otherwise.
Examples
Example #1 check_active() example
main { if(check_active(BUTTON_19, 5000)) { set_val(BUTTON_5, 100.0); } }
